Complete 32-bit MPU. 5-Gbyte linear address space. Co-
processor interface. Instruction cache. Dynamic bus sizing.
Excellent MPU for graphics control. On-chip cache speeds
drawing algorithms. Bit field support for pixel manipulation.
(RP and FE packages not recommended for new designs.)
32-bit data bus MPU with 24-bit address bus. Instruction
cache. Dynamic bus sizing. Coprocessor interface. Low-cost
packaging. (RP packages not recommended for new designs.)
Complete 32-bit MPU with on-chip instruction and data
caches, internal parallel buses, enhanced bus controller,
and on-chip MMU. (RP packages not recommended for new
designs.)
32-bit MPU for embedded applications. On-chip instruction
and data caches provide high-speed access for control rou-
tines and data. Utilizes low-cost DRAM bus interface.
(RP packages not recommended for new designs.)
Complete 32-bit MPU with on-chip instruction/data caches
(4k bytes each). On-chip MMU. Full IEEE floating point,
multiprocessing support with full M68000 Family compatibil-
ity.
High-performance 32-bit MPU with on-chip instruction and
data cache provides high-speed access for control routines
and data. Utilizes low-cost DRAM bus interface.
68040-compatible integer unit and MMU. Ideal solution for
cost-sensitive computer or sophisticated embedded
applications.
Low-voltage complete 32-bit MPU with on-chip instruction/
data caches (4k bytes each). On-chip MMU. Multiprocessing
support.
RISC hybrid superscalar MPU with full M68000 Family
compatibility. Includes dual integer units, on-chip instruction/
data caches (8K bytes each), on-chip MMU, and full IEEE
compliant FPU.
RISC hybrid superscalar MPU with full M68000 Family com-
patibility. Includes dual integer units, on-chip instruction/data
caches (8K bytes each). Ideal for high-performance embed-
ded control applications.
RISC hybrid superscalar MPU with full M68000 Family com-
patibility. Includes dual integer units, on-chip instruction/data
caches (8K bytes each) and on-chip MMU.
Pin-to-pin timing and software compatibility with MC68881.
Dual ported registers and increased pipelining allows 2-4
performance of MC68881.
